Mark Andersen leads quite a lonely existence in the Alaskan wilderness, where he lives with his mother and father. Things wouldn't be so lonely if his older brother was still around, but since his death, Mark has been devoid of contact with anyone even close in age to him. Due in large part to the fact that he's the smallest boy at school - at least for his age - and risks injury if he plays with the stronger boys, so he keeps to himself. That is, until he discovers a friend named Ben. Ben isn't your average friend. He's ... Read More:

This book was a joy to me.
A bear named Henry has made a bet with his friend about the best way to get to Fitchburg. Henry, who begins to seem a lot like Henry David Thoreau walks while his friend earns money to take the train. His friend hires on with various families whose names are those of the American Transcendentalist: Alcott, Hawthorne, Emerson.
Henry walks and observes natures. His experience is the journey, while his friend toils for the goal.
The book is beautifully illustrated, well-told and thought ... Read More:
